Understanding the IELTS Academic Certificate: A Comprehensive Guide
The International English Language Testing System (IELTS) is an internationally recognized English language proficiency test for non-native English speakers. It is widely accepted by universities, employers, and immigration authorities in many countries, especially in the UK, Australia, Canada, and New Zealand. The IELTS Academic test is specifically created for trainees who want to study at the undergraduate or postgraduate levels in an English-speaking environment. What is the IELTS Academic Test?
The IELTS Academic test is among the 2 primary versions of the IELTS exam, the other being the IELTS General Training test. The Academic variation is customized for people who prepare to apply for greater education or expert registration in an English-speaking country. The test examines the candidate's capability to understand and utilize academic English in a range of contexts, including lectures, workshops, and composed assignments.
Structure of the IELTS Academic Test
The IELTS Academic test consists of 4 sections: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Each section is created to assess various aspects of English language proficiency.
Listening (30 minutes)
The Listening section consists of four tape-recorded passages, ranging from monologues to discussions, followed by 40 questions. The passages are usually set in everyday social contexts and academic settings.
Abilities Assessed: Understanding essences, particular info, and the speaker's attitude or viewpoint.
